Milk is when you basically squeeze paid content out of a game without much or any improvement (i.e., Call of Duty).

The idea behind milking a franchise, per se, is that the company invests as little as possible in researching or developing new software or middleware to support the release of a game (or additional content) at full retail price.

A lot of franchises this gen fall into that category.

Grand Theft Auto IV, Red Dead Redemption, Gran Turismo and Forza Motorsport are a few games/franchises that supercede this standard because the developers each time have gone out of their way to improve, enhance and innovate the gameplay.
